Former sports editor and current Managing Editor at The Gateway (the official student newspaper of the University of Alberta — www.thegatewayonline.ca) I've been involved with journalism going on five years now, and hope to become a hockey writer at some point. I've been a fan of the sport (and sports in general) from as far back as I can remember.

Thus far, I've had the pleasure of interviewing Jordan Eberle and Ryan O'Marra (Edmonton Oilers prospects), Rob Daum (head coach of the AHL's Springfield Falcons), Don Horwood (former University of Alberta men's basketball coach, CBC commentator during 1996 Summer Olympics), among others.
